Gameplay Settings and Adjustments
Some gamers additionally recounted their individual triumphs by adjusting various configurations. For example, user paziek disclosed that transitioning to exclusive fullscreen mode significantly improved their gaming performance. Surprisingly, they mentioned that their game ran smoothly in borderless window mode, which added to the puzzle about the source of the problem! Other advice encompassed deactivating overlays from platforms such as NVIDIA and Discord or shutting off frame generation altogether. These tips suggest a growing awareness among gamers about the nuances of game settings, implying that tinkering with visuals can yield significant changes—either in terms of performance or comfort.
